SOC-205Z  Social Change and Institutions  
4 credits, Fall/Winter/Spring  
Sociological analysis of social institutions, such as family, education, health care, the economy, and the state. Includes an examination of connections among institutions and their impact on patterns of inequality and individual outcomes. Examines the forces and dynamics behind social change, such as social movements, culture, economic forces, technologies, and the environment.
Recommended Prerequisites: WRD-098 or placement in WR-121Z
